Key insights

  • Voice Isolation is an AI-powered audio feature in Microsoft Teams that isolates your voice and suppresses background sounds.
    It uses speech models to keep meetings clear even in noisy places.
  • To enable on your device, open Teams Settings, go to Recognition, then Create voice profile.
    Pick your microphone, record the sample, and Voice Isolation activates automatically during calls with a small indicator.
  • Admins control access via meeting policies and can enable or disable enrollment with the enrollUserOverride policy.
    They can also manage biometric profiles and use PowerShell to apply restrictions to users or groups.
  • Privacy rules: Microsoft does not use enrolled voice profiles to train its core AI models.
    Data retention notes: inactive profiles delete after one year; profiles from deleted or unlicensed accounts remove after 90 days; exports are allowed until November 2025.
  • Benefits include clearer calls, better speech recognition, and improved meeting focus in cafés, open offices, or home environments.
    The feature delivers more than basic noise reduction by isolating your unique voice.
  • Availability is broad as of late 2025 and it is enabled by default for many tenants, but admins may restrict it.
    Ensure your Teams app and microphone drivers are up to date to get the best results.
